Definition: Evergreen Cherry |
Evergreen CherryNoun1. California evergreen wild plum with spiny leathery leaves and white flowers. Source: WordNet 1.7.1 Copyright © 2001 by Princeton University. All rights reserved. |
Synonyms: Evergreen CherrySynonyms: holly-leaf cherry (n), holly-leaved cherry (n), islay (n). (additional references) |
